Academic Team selling tickets on Fred Thrasher print Money will help pay for trip to Quiz Bowl National Championship The Adair County Academic Team is selling raffle tickets on a Fred Thrasher print, "Nature's Retreat," a 20"x16" print of a scene set at the natural bridge at Rockhouse Bottom in Creelsboro. Tickets are $5 per ticket or $20 per 5 tickets. The money will be used for the Quiz Bowl National Championship in Chicagoand the International FPS Championships in Michigan. You may purchase a ticket at any of the following locations: Flowers 'N Things, Tray's Garden, ACHS Library, or Petty's Supply (Flatwoods/Sparksville). The drawing for the Fred Thrasher print will be held on May 20, 2008. Thank you for your support. Brett Reliford ACHS Academic Team This story was posted on 2008-05-07 19:10:54
